We're trying out a new distribution channel with our latest DopperPress release. It's called Draft2Digital and will make our books available on many different online sellers, including Amazon, Apple, SmashWords, Kobo and more!
We get a wider world footprint, more flexible pricing, more help with promotion and simpler uploading for eBooks as well as better potential for producing paperbacks and audio books.
We give up getting paid by Kindle for the Kindle Unlimited borrows of our books but only for our new releases in this new channel. :) That's not trivial, about 1/4 of our income from Kindle so far has been through the Kindle Unlimited offerings. For some of our books, we may keep the KU availability because it is kind of a good deal for readers, too. But Kobo and some of the other new distributors also offer subscriptions, so we will have to see.
Current plans are that all new releases will be in the new channel, and once or twice a month, we will re-release a book from our back catalog through D2D, possibly including paperback or audiobook versions.
It looks like new releases will not appear on Kindle quite as fast as when we released direct to Kindle but our newest book, Like for Like is already available on 5 to 7 other platforms!
